Companionship care is about presence and reassurance. Typical tasks include friendly conversation, accompanying someone to appointments or cafés, helping with hobbies and crafts, light household tasks like tidying or making a meal, and offering reassurance during evening or weekend visits. Many people want regular, dependable company rather than intimate personal care, so you’ll focus on building relationships and bringing calm to a client’s day.

Pay varies by client and the care required; carers on PrimeCarers typically charge in the range £19–£22.20 per hour. You decide the hourly rate that reflects your experience, travel and the time you give to each person. Many carers also offer short outings or longer companionship visits that are agreed directly with families.

To join you’ll need at least one year of professional care experience, the right to work in the UK, an Enhanced DBS check (we can help arrange this), and verifiable references. You’ll remain self-employed, so you’ll manage your own tax and National Insurance. What carers earn around Wokingham

Carers on PrimeCarers are self-employed and set their own rates. Typical ranges are based on what carers in the area currently charge.

Hourly care

Based on 109 carers in the area

£19–£22.20 per hour

Overnight care

Based on 98 carers in the area

£17–£20 per hour

Live-in care

Based on 1350 carers in the area

£148–£164.50 per day
